# Question Refinement Loop
迭代精化研究问题 — 反复打磨直到通过 FINER 5 项标准。
## 编排意图
将"精化问题"结构化为:检验 → 识别问题 → 修正 → 重新检验的循环。每轮聚焦于未通过的标准项。
## 可用 SOPs
| SOP | 职责 | 何时调用 |
|-----|------|---------|
| finer-criteria-check | FINER 5 项标准逐项检验 | 每轮循环的检验步骤 |
| scope-assessment | 评估问题范围是否合适 | 当 F(Feasible) 不通过时 |
| success-criteria-definition | 定义可测量的成功标准 | 循环结束后,确认 RQ 可衡量 |
## 编排模式
**标准循环**:
1. finer-criteria-check → 获得 5 项判定
2. 如果全通过 → 调用 success-criteria-definition → 结束
3. 如果有未通过项 → 针对性修正:
- F 不通过 → scope-assessment → 缩小范围
- I 不通过 → 增强理论动机
- N 不通过 → 检查文献确认新颖性
- E 不通过 → 调整研究设计
- R 不通过 → 强化实践意义
4. 修正后回到步骤 1
**最大迭代**: 3 轮。超过 3 轮仍不通过 → 报告哪项持续不通过 + 建议根本性调整方向。
## Minimum Yield
- RQ 通过 FINER 5/5
- Success criteria 定义完成(可测量)
- 如果 3 轮未通过:明确报告问题项 + 建议
## Yield Report
执行完成后报告:
- 迭代轮次
- 每轮的 FINER 结果
- 最终 RQ 表述
- Success criteria
